Gate: `python scripts/check-image-pins.py` (run after any compose change; exit 1 on any floating/missing tag). - **A pinned tag can still rot away upstream** — the pin gate is syntactic and cannot see that. Second gate: `python3 scripts/check-image-resolvable.py` (exit 0 resolve / 1 GONE / 2 inconclusive), run at the start of every catalog campaign and before any publish train that vouches the catalog. Needs network + `docker`; unauthenticated Docker Hub throttles a full sweep, so `docker login` first or expect exit 2. It reports a throttle as INCONCLUSIVE, never as a dead image. - **A well-formed template can still preserve the wrong folder** — and no static check can see it. Third gate, the only RUNTIME one: `python3 scripts/check-volume-persistence.py` (0 all clean / **1 REFUSED** / 2 undecided). It deploys each template, exercises it into writing data, and compares where the data landed against what the compose mounts. Needs Docker + network and minutes per app, so it is periodic like the resolvability gate — run it whenever a template's `volumes:` block or image tag changes, and at the start of every catalog campaign, **on a scratch host, never a customer box**. It refuses to report at all unless it has just re-proven itself in both directions against two canary templates. Fixture tests (no Docker): `python3 scripts/test_check_volume_persistence.py`. **UNDETERMINED is exit 2 and is never a pass** — an app that wrote nothing has not been shown to be correct. Why it exists: papra mounted `papra_data:/app/data` while the app wrote its database to `/app/app-data/db/`, so its backup completed, verified, and contained an empty directory (R-156, Campaign 10). - **Taking an app out of circulation — use `lifecycle:`, never a directory move.** `.felhom.yml` gains an optional `lifecycle:` field: `available` (default; absent/empty means this), `hidden` (not offered for new installs, no explanation owed), `abandoned` (upstream stopped developing it — not offered for new installs, and every box already running it shows a permanent "Nem karbantartott" notice). **Deployed instances keep working in full either way** — the state affects what is OFFERED, never what already runs, and the controller REFUSES a deploy of a non-available template server-side.
